Представлен выпуск свободной загрузочной прошивки Libreboot 20230413. Следующему обновлению планируют присвоить статус официального стабильного релиза Libreboot. Проект развивает готовую сборку проекта coreboot, предоставляющую замену проприетарным прошивкам UEFI и BIOS, отвечающим за инициализации CPU, памяти, периферийных устройств и других компонентов оборудования, с минимизацией бинарных вставок.
Libreboot нацелен на формирование системного окружения, позволяющего полностью обойтись без проприетарного ПО, не только на уровне операционной системы, но и прошивок, обеспечивающих загрузку. Libreboot не просто очищает coreboot от несвободных компонентов, но и дополняет его средствами для упрощения применения конечными пользователями, формируя дистрибутив, которым может воспользоваться любой пользователь, не имеющий специальных навыков.
Среди поддерживаемого в Libreboot оборудования:
- Десктоп-системы Gigabyte GA-G41M-ES2L, Intel D510MO, Intel D410PT, Intel D945GCLF и Apple iMac 5,2.
- Ноутбуки: ThinkPad X60 / X60S / X60 Tablet, ThinkPad T60, Lenovo ThinkPad X200 / X200S / X200 Tablet/ X220 / X230, Lenovo ThinkPad R400, Lenovo ThinkPad T400 / T400S/ T420 / T440, Lenovo ThinkPad T500 / T530, Lenovo ThinkPad W500 / W530, Lenovo ThinkPad R500, Apple MacBook1 и MacBook2, а также различные устройства Chromebook от компаний ASUS, Samsung, Acer и HP.
В новом выпуске:
- В утилите util/nvmutil проведена чистка кода и улучшена обработка ошибок.
- Упрощёна подстановка скриптов в ROM-образы для sandybridge, ivybridge и haswell.
- Возобновлена поставка образов с mrc.bin для плат с процессорами на базе микроархитектуры Haswell (ноутбуки ThinkPad T440p и ThinkPad W541). Для подобных плат также доступна экспериментальная реализация кода для инициализации памяти (raminit), позволяющая обойтись без файла MRC (Memory Reference Code).
- Из сборочной системы исключены некоторые проблемные платы, поставка ROM-образов для которых была прекращена в прошлых выпусках (в будущем поставку данных образов планируют возобновить).